Interpreting I2C Decode

• Angled waveforms show an active bus (inside a packet/frame).
• Mid-level blue lines show an idle bus.
• In the decoded hexadecimal data:

• Aliased bus values (undersampled or indeterminate) are drawn in pink.
Keysight InfiniiVision 2000 X-Series Oscilloscopes User's Guide
Address values appear at the start of a frame.
Write addresses appear in light-blue along with the "W" character.
Read addresses appear in yellow along with the "R" character.
Restart addresses appear in green along with the "S" character.
Data values appear in white.
"A" indicates Ack (low), "~A" indicates No Ack (high).
Decoded text is truncated at the end of the associated frame when there is
insufficient space within frame boundaries.
